Good things to know

Which word is more common?

Merging is more commonly used than compositing in everyday language, as it has broader applications in various industries and contexts. Compositing is more specific to creative fields such as film and graphic design.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between compositing and merging?

Both compositing and merging can be used in formal and informal contexts, depending on the industry and context in which they are used.
